About House of Hope Foundation Inc House of Hope

House of Hope Foundation provides residential treatment for women in San Pedro, California, serving diverse populations including veterans, young adults, and pregnant women. This CARF-accredited recovery center combines CBT, 12-step philosophy, and comprehensive aftercare support for long-term recovery success.

House of Hope Foundation operates as a residential treatment facility in San Pedro, California, serving the Los Angeles and South Bay communities since 1955. This women-focused recovery center provides specialized care for substance use disorders, alcohol use disorders, co-occurring disorders, and trauma-related conditions in a dedicated residential setting.

The residential treatment program addresses the full spectrum of addiction recovery needs, treating substance abuse and alcohol dependency alongside co-occurring mental health conditions and trauma. Their comprehensive approach includes family group counseling, relapse prevention programming, and specialized services for veterans, young adults aged 18-25, and pregnant women requiring substance abuse treatment.

Treatment at House of Hope combines c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) with 12-step philosophy principles, offering both in-person and telehealth options. The recovery center emphasizes practical life skills through specialized groups covering parenting, anger management, grief and loss, domestic violence, and conflict resolution as core components of their residential program.

House of Hope serves women from diverse backgrounds, including court-ordered clients, veterans, and those living with HIV/AIDS who need comprehensive addiction treatment. CARF accreditation demonstrates their commitment to quality care, while multiple payment options including Medicaid, private insurance, and sliding scale fees make residential treatment accessible to the recovery community throughout Los Angeles County.
